To determine the alternative hypothesis in this context, we need to understand the definitions of the null and alternative hypotheses. 1. **Null Hypothesis (H0)**: This is a statement that there is no effect or no difference. In this case, it would state that there is no increase in the number of students accessing the school library. 2. **Alternative Hypothesis (H1)**: This is what you want to prove; it suggests that there is an effect or a difference. In this case, it would state that there is an increase in the number of students accessing the school library. Given the options provided: - **There is no increase in the number of students accessing the school library.** (This represents the null hypothesis.) - **There is an increase in the number of students accessing the school library.** (This represents the alternative hypothesis.) Therefore, the alternative hypothesis is: **There is an increase in the number of students accessing the school library.**
